Call Your Insurance Company
It is worth calling your insurance company to file a claim if the damaged window was caused by an event related to weather or other external causes. This could help speed things up and get the repairs done quicker. It is also possible to find a repair shop that is "in-network" with your insurance. This could lower the amount you'll have to pay.
Even if your insurance won't cover the damage, it's worth calling to find out what you'll need to pay anyway for emergency repairs. This will help you budget for the expenses and Window Repair avoid surprises when it comes to paying the bill.

Contact the Police
It could be necessary to contact the police immediately when your window is damaged. This is especially true when the window was damaged by vandalism or burglary. Calling the police will aid in catching the criminal, as providing you with a police report that can be used to file an insurance claim.
After you have contacted the police and your insurance company, you should take as much as possible to protect your home from burglars until glass repair takes place. Your home is at risk to pests and weather, which could put your family in danger.
If you have children, it's also important to keep them out of the area until the police come and make sure that it is safe for them to go into your home once more. It could be risky to walk on broken pieces of glass.
You should wait until the police are finished with their investigation before cleaning the broken glasses. If you do, it could make it harder to make a successful claim with your insurance company for the damage. Certain homeowners' insurance companies require photos and other proof of the damaged window before they consider an insurance claim. Some adjusters prefer to visit homes prior to deciding on a claim. This is often the case, particularly after a burglary. The adjuster will determine the extent of damage and the amount of theft. They can then collaborate with the homeowner to make sure that they're able to recover their belongings and money.

Covering the breakage with a board, or a different type of temporary cover will not just make your home or business more secure, but will also help you save money. Covering a window that has been damaged will lower your energy bill until the repair is completed.
Use plywood as a temporary cover to protect your windows from the elements until a professional can fix your window. You can buy an item of plywood that is the same size as your window at a variety of hardware or home improvement stores. You can then fix it on the wood studs in the frame on both sides. If you don't own any plywood, you can still protect yourself by using the large sheet of plastic or tarp.

Temporary Fix
If your window is cracked however it could be possible to create an interim fix by using tape. This will close the gap and stop air from entering your house. This is crucial, particularly when you live in a region that has a cold climate.
Be sure to remove all glass shards out of the area prior to applying any tape. This will safeguard your family members and window repair decrease the possibility of anyone being injured by the glass. This is also an excellent time to wear eye protection and thick gloves.
